Latest Patents
Mary F. Krystofik holds a patent for an "Imaging Module Mounting Structure." This invention is designed for mounting an imaging module to an imaging device that features a support member and a rotatable photoreceptor. The imaging module consists of an imaging bar and a corona generating device. The mounting structure includes a pair of pivot block devices that are pivotably connected to the support member in a spaced apart relationship. Each pivot block device is equipped with a cam follower element, allowing them to flex independently while maintaining contact with the rotating photoreceptor. This design compensates for photoreceptor run out, enhancing the overall functionality of the imaging device.
Career Highlights
Mary has had a distinguished career, primarily working with Xerox Corporation. Her role at this leading technology company has allowed her to develop and refine her innovative ideas, contributing to the advancement of imaging technologies.
Collaborations
Throughout her career, Mary has collaborated with esteemed colleagues such as James W. Patterson and Eugene J. Manno. These partnerships have fostered a creative environment that has led to the development of groundbreaking technologies in the imaging sector.
